ALBAY, Philippines — The Office of the Ombudsman described the transmission of referrals from the Independent Commission for Infrastructure (ICI) as part of a “natural flow,” following the resignation of Commissioner Rossana Fajardo, effective Dec. 31, 2025. "Now, with a new Ombudsman ready to take on the task, the ICI was quick to relay their referrals for further fact-finding and/or preliminary investigation," Clavano said. "The exposure is high especially for those who head the commission,” Clavano said, calling it “noble” for private individuals to take on such a daunting task at a pivotal moment in the country’s history. "It is only a matter of time before we see more cases filed in court - many upon the recommendation of the ICI," Clavano said.
